The three steps of the writing process, in order from first to last, are prewriting, writing, and revision. Prewriting involves brainstorming, researching, and outlining ideas for your piece.

This step helps you gather and organize your thoughts before you begin the actual writing process. Writing is the actual creation of your written piece. This step involves putting your ideas and thoughts into words and sentences. Finally, revision is the process of reviewing and refining your work. It involves making changes to the content, organization, and style of your writing to improve its clarity and effectiveness.

A sample deliberately constructed to reflect several of the major characteristics of the universe being studied is called a representative sample.

A representative sample is a subset of a larger population that accurately reflects the key characteristics and diversity of that population. It is carefully selected to ensure that it contains individuals or elements that are representative of the entire group under study. This type of sampling is important in research and data analysis as it allows researchers to make valid and reliable inferences about the population based on the findings from the sample.

To create a representative sample, researchers use various techniques such as random sampling, stratified sampling, or cluster sampling. Random sampling ensures that each member of the population has an equal chance of being selected, while stratified sampling divides the population into subgroups and selects participants from each subgroup in proportion to their representation in the population. Cluster sampling involves selecting groups or clusters from the population rather than individual elements.

By using a representative sample, researchers can generalize their findings to the larger population with confidence. It helps in reducing bias and increasing the validity of the study's conclusions. A well-constructed representative sample ensures that the characteristics, behaviors, and trends observed in the sample accurately reflect those of the entire population.

The metrical form that Alexander Pope is said to have brought to perfection in "An Essay on Man" is the (d) heroic couplet.

The excerpt you provided demonstrates the use of heroic couplets, which consist of pairs of lines written in iambic pentameter and end in a rhymed couplet. This form was widely employed by Pope and became one of his signature poetic styles.

The heroic couplet's regular rhythm and rhyme scheme provide a balanced and harmonious structure to the poem, allowing Pope to convey his ideas with clarity and wit. The form was influential in 18th-century English poetry and is closely associated with Pope's works.

Answer: Alan Lomax was a prominent American ethnomusicologist, folklorist, and field collector of traditional music. He is known for his extensive recordings and documentation of folk music from various parts of the world, but especially from the United States, the Caribbean, and the British Isles.

Lomax worked for the Library of Congress and traveled throughout the United States, recording and documenting traditional folk music and culture, often with the help of his father, John Lomax. He also produced radio programs, films, and publications that showcased the music and culture he had recorded. His work was influential in the folk music revival of the 1950s and 1960s, and many of his recordings have become important historical documents and primary sources for the study of folk music and culture.

Lomax is also known for his advocacy of cultural equity and social justice, and he worked to promote the recognition and preservation of traditional cultural expressions, especially those of marginalized and minority communities. His legacy has continued to inspire and inform the fields of ethnomusicology, folklore, and cultural studies.

The ancient principle of limited citizenship is not present in the United States political process today. Limited citizenship was a concept prevalent in ancient Greece and Rome, where only a select group of people had the full rights and privileges of citizenship, while others had limited rights or no rights at all.

In contrast, the United States has a system of universal citizenship, where all citizens are considered equal before the law and have the same rights and opportunities. The Constitution guarantees equal protection under the law to all citizens, regardless of their race, religion, or social status.

The principles of civic participation, republic, and elected officials are all present in the United States political process. Civic participation is encouraged through the right to vote and the freedom of speech and assembly. The country operates as a republic, where citizens elect representatives to make decisions on their behalf. Elected officials at the federal, state, and local levels hold positions of power and authority, and are held accountable through elections and the rule of law.
